Fujitsu and Software AG Sign Strategic Partnership Agreement
Following the March 1, 2005 announcement of a strategic alliance between the two companies, Fujitsu and Software AG have signed a Strategic Partnership Agreement to jointly develop and market CentraSite. Additionally, Fujitsu will market Software AG's Enterprise Service Integrator and Enterprise Information Integrator, and Software AG will market Fujitsu's Interstage Business Process Manager.
Business benefits include lower cost and cycle times of integration projects through maximized re-use of SOA components, increased responsiveness to customer requirements, a richer collaboration environment within project teams or across organizational teams, business risk mitigation through the ability to measure change impact, and less burdensome implementation of governance and compliance initiatives.

Software AG provides a real-time single view of strategic business information by integrating applications and systems, in addition to modernizing mainframe and open system IT environments. Its offerings are based on the product families Adabas, Natural, ApplinX, EntireX and Tamino. Around 2,500 employees in 59 countries support the mission-critical systems of 3,000 customers around the world. The company maintains five R&D facilities across three continents. Founded in 1969, Software AG today is Europe's largest and most established systems software provider. It is headquartered in Darmstadt, Germany and is listed on the Frankfurt Stock Exchange (TecDAX, ISIN DE 0003304002 / SOW). In 2004 Software AG posted 411 million euros in total revenue.
Fujitsu is the leading Japanese information and communication technology (ICT) company offering a full range of technology products, solutions and services. Over 170,000 Fujitsu people support customers in more than 100 countries. We use our experience and the power of ICT to shape the future of society with our customers. Fujitsu Limited (TSE:6702) reported consolidated revenues of 4.5 trillion yen (US$54 billion) for the fiscal year ended March 31, 2012. For more information, please see: www.fujitsu.com
